Carelia BISTRO
( MAP GOOGLE MAP ; 09-2709-0976; www.carelia.info ;Mannerheimintie 56;mains €24-30;
4pm-midnight Mon-Sat)
Opposite the Oopperatalo, this is a striking spot set in a former pharmacy for a pre- or
post-show drink or meal. Glamorously decorated in period style, it offers smart bistro fare
and plenty of intriguing wines by the glass.
Kolme Kruunua FINNISH
( MAP GOOGLE MAP ; 09-135-4172; www.kolmekruunua.fi ; Liisankatu 5;mains €15-23; food
4pm-midnight Mon-Sat, 2-11pm Sun)
This unpretentious Finnish local in the suburb of Kruununhaka offers tasty no-frills Fin-
nish dishes such as fried vendace or sausages and mash in a fabulously retro dining area
that hasn't changed since the 1950s. It's all very tasty, and you might want to try a couple
of the other bars hereabouts, very traditional in feel and off the tourist trail.
Ateljé Finne MODERN FINNISH
( MAP GOOGLE MAP ; 010-281-8242; www.ateljefinne.fi ;Arkadiankatu 14;2/3 courses €39/45;
5-10pm Tue-Sat)
Good-value modern cuisine at this elegant but relaxed spot. The menu changes regularly
but the daily fish dish is always great.

SLAUGHTERHOUSE SNACKS
Teurastamo FOOD COURT
( MAP GOOGLE MAP ; www.teurastamo.com ;Työpajankatu 2)
This former abattoir area between Sörnäinen and Kalasatama metro stations is an in
place to be these days, with a range of locally sourcing eateries opening up in this casual
post-industrial precinct. Choose to snack on dim sum, smokehouse fare, fresh pasta and
more, or bring your own meat to grill and graze the kitchen garden for herbs and veget-
ables.
